Former PM Wins Presidential Election Of Kyrgyzstan

The Central Election Commission (CEC) of Kyrgyzstan announced on Monday that the former Prime Minister Sooronbai Jeenbekov has won the presidential election.....
The presidential elections were held on Oct. 15. 11 candidates took part in the competition and 1,697,868 voters casted their votes out of 3,140,434 elligible voters.

According to the CEC, Jeenbekov won the elections with 54.22 percent of the votes. The second place was taken by presidential candidate Omurbek Babanov, who scored 33.49 percent of votes.

58-year-old Jeenbekov served as Prime Minister since April 2016 until nomination as presidential candidate from Social Democratic Party of Kyrgyzstan (SDPK).

The term of the incumbent President Almazbek Atambayev ends on Dec. 1.
